Using Asia's finest silk brocades, the Messenger Bag blends exotic glamour and practical necessity. Designed with Mum in mind - this bag has a pocket for everything and enough room to cater for more than one! It features multiple interior and external pockets to separate essential baby items.

Included in the bag as separate accessories are the dummy holder, bottle thermos, wetpack and change mat. There is an internal key clip and an external pocket designed to keep your mobile phone and other essential items close at hand.

The VANCHI Messenger bag has everything you could possibly want in a baby bag and more. An essential purchase for any new mum.

Sapphire Blue with Ebony lining

Dimensions: 38L x 31H x 16W cm
